Transaction 5772c63d943cab76e86414413571df83334cb674f812213fdde4b93e6465509a

1 Input
2 Outputs
  • 5772c63d943cab76e86414413571df83334cb674f812213fdde4b93e6465509a:0
  • value  2754858
    address  37thWn68b1wJKqAUfVqcwYc2WVCxmWBYE4
  • 5772c63d943cab76e86414413571df83334cb674f812213fdde4b93e6465509a:1
  • value  6426938
    address  3FU2VkPgeif9wBG9ZFFnjcmphnKPgkLMqZ